The bottom line

The Ordinary Retinol 0.5% in Squalane and Vichy Minéral 89 Hyaluronic Acid Booster land in much the same place on performance, so value decides it: The Ordinary Retinol 0.5% in Squalane does the same job for less.

Vichy Minéral 89 Hyaluronic Acid Booster keeps clear of pregnancy-flagged actives, while The Ordinary Retinol 0.5% in Squalane carries one that is best paused in pregnancy.

Which should you pick?

Pick Retinol 0.5% in Squalane if

  • fine lines and firmness are the goal
  • you want the more affordable option
  • you want more actives working at once

Pick Minéral 89 Hyaluronic Acid Booster if

  • plump, lasting hydration is what you want
  • you are prone to fungal acne (malassezia)
  • you are pregnant or breastfeeding

Can I use The Ordinary Retinol 0.5% in Squalane and Vichy Minéral 89 Hyaluronic Acid Booster together?

They are both serums, so you would normally pick one rather than layer both in the same step. You can keep both and alternate them (morning and night, or on different days) if you like variety, but you do not need two.
